Van-Far picked up a crucial victory in its final home game on Monday.
The Lady Indians beat Class 1 District 4 opponent Marion County 10-0 in six innings for their 20th straight victory over Marion County (5-7) and third win in four matchups against district foes. Ady Barnett tossed her first career no-hitter with eight strikeouts and two walks in six innings. Van-Far (7-13), who has a four-season high in wins this season, had seven girls finish with at least one RBI. Emily Smith had the walk-off two-RBI single in the sixth inning, and one RBI each came from Kylee Gibson, Adrianna Craven, Bryanna Stanich, Makenna Hall, Kenya Jones and Ashlyn Marshall.
Van-Far (3-5 EMO) plays at Eastern Missouri Conference foe Wright City (8-16, 1-6 EMO) at 4:30 p.m. Tuesday.
